First, let's address the elephant in the room: neither of these sides knows how to keep a clean sheet. Union Berlin have managed just one shutout in their last ten outings, conceding at an average of 1.80 goals per game. At home, it's even worse—they're shipping 2.25 goals per contest. On the other side, Eintracht Frankfurt are in an even deeper defensive crisis, with a single clean sheet in ten and a staggering 2.30 goals conceded on average. On the road, they're a charity case, letting in 2.40 per game. If you're looking for defensive solidity, look elsewhere. This is my kind of party.
Recent results paint a vivid picture of chaos. Union's last three Bundesliga games saw them lose 3-1 to a rampant Hoffenheim, get thumped 3-0 by Dortmund, and draw 1-1 with Stuttgart. They're scoring (1.40 per game) but leaking goals like a sieve. Frankfurt's form is arguably more entertaining, with a 3-3 draw against Dortmund, a 3-3 draw with Werder Bremen, and losses of 3-1 to Hoffenheim and 3-2 to Stuttgart. Their last five matches across all competitions have averaged over 3.2 total goals. The pattern is clear: both teams score, and they do it often—hitting an 80% 'Both Teams to Score' rate over their last ten.
The head-to-head history adds more fuel to the fire. The last time these two met, in September 2025, they served up a seven-goal classic ending 4-3. While not every past meeting has been a goal-fest, that recent memory combined with current form is a powerful indicator. The underlying numbers are just as juicy. Union averages 1.75 goals scored at home, while Frankfurt nets 1.80 on their travels. Combine those, and you're looking at a baseline expectation of 3.55 goals before we even consider their generous defences.
Some might point to recent declining scoring trends, but those are for individual teams. When you look at the total goals in their recent matches—Union's last three averaging 3.0 total goals, Frankfurt's averaging 3.33—the picture remains overwhelmingly in favour of action. With six days' rest for both, fatigue shouldn't be a mitigating factor.
